Esuno Sakae wrote Mirai Nikki and is currently writing Big Order. Hoshimiya Eiji and Kurenai Rin in Big Order bear a great resemblance to Amano Yukiteru and Gasai Yuno in Future Diary respectively.
To recap Future Diary, Yuki and Yuno fight in the battle royale to become god. Later we find that Yuno actually became god in the first incarnation of the world and prompted the second world to be with Yuki. Yuki, in turn, became god of the second world after Yuno died. In the end, Yuno's next incarnation and Yuki together inherit the right to become god of the third world, replacing the god who finally expired.

In Big Order, Eiji like Yuki is the key player for controlling the world, and Rin like Yuno has a twisted fixation has on Eiji. What if the world of Big Order was the fourth world of Mirai Nikki? At the end of the third world, Yuno and Yuki are about to die when they realize they want to create a fourth world where they can be together again, rather than relive all the heartbreak of Mirai Nikki. Together Yuno and Yuki create a new world (the world of Big Order), and they reincarnate themselves as Rin and Eiji respectively. Because it's impossible to recreate the same people entirely, Rin and Eiji obtain their own identities, separate from Yuno and Yuki.
Without a proper heir to become god, Yuno and Yuki design the world of Big Order to include a game of world domination instead of the extreme battle royale from Future Diary. Simultaneously, both Yuno and Yuki hope that Eiji and Rin become the next god.
